Has anybody here ever moved from Apache to IIS with moodle?

 

We have had moodle for about 9 months on a Windows 2003 Server box using Apache.

 

I have somthing that is ASP based that i want to put on the same box, but apache apparently out of the box does not support asp. I've seen some addon's but i do not want to mess too much.

 

Now is there a simple way for me to move from apache to IIS with very little downtime for moodle?

just a thought and im sure someone will clear this up if i have got it completely wrong........ but

 

the ASP app that you have got, could you not set up IIS but have it listening on another port for the ASP and then that way you dont have to worry about messing with your moodle set up

 

Like i said i dont know if this will work and have never tired it just an idea
